Registration Under Way For 71st Annual Lansdale Mardi Gras Parade Nov. 19


It's that time of year again! Discover Lansdale is bringing back the borough's beloved Annual Mardi Gras Parade for its 71st year on Saturday, Nov. 19, starting at 1 p.m.

Every year, the Saturday before Thanksgiving, the North Penn community turns out to line Main Street's sidewalks and cheer as marchers, dancers, bands, floats, fire trucks and other vehicles roll down the boulevard together to ring in the season and escort Santa to town.
 
This year's theme is Victorian Holidays; participants are welcome to design presentations around that theme, or use their imagination to devise a theme all their own.

Organizations, businesses, nonprofits and neighborhoods are encouraged to participate. Day-of volunteers are also needed to help carry on the tradition.

Community organizations and nonprofits can enter at no charge; commercial entries are invited to register as sponsors, with the fee remaining at $100 for 2022 (participants in Lansdale's 150th Anniversary Parade in August can register at half price).

First place prizes will be awarded for the best presentation in each entry type, except for floats, which will be awarded Best Presentation of Parade Theme; Best Presentation of Non-Commercial Entry; and Mayor’s Choice.

Parade-day details will be emailed about a week before the event. Please make sure that the entry's email address is correct and clearly printed on the form. All entries must be received no later than November 1.

One note: No extra Santas, please. The "carrying” of Santa Claus is strictly prohibited, according to Discover Lansdale. It's part of the finale, where the honor goes to one area fire department. In addition, all emergency services are asked to limit their truck equipment entries to 5 total.
 
As participants in the parade, many groups don't get a chance to purchase collectible commemorative parade buttons each year. So groups also can pre-order and pre-pay for buttons through their registration. Buttons cost $1, display the theme of the parade and help fund the parade.
